The Mathematical Solution

Gauss' Algorithm

The sum of the first 1000 positive integers can be calculated using a clever method attributed to the famous mathematician Carl Friedrich Gauss. Gauss devised a method that simplified the problem by pairing numbers in a strategic way.

Here's the step-by-step process:

tConsider the sum of the 1st and the last integer: 1 1000 1001. tConsider the sum of the 2nd and the 2nd-to-last integer: 2 999 1001. tContinue this process until all pairs are summed up, and each pair will also equal 1001. tThere are 500 such pairs (since 1000 divided by 2 is 500). tThe total sum is then: 1001 * 500 500500.
